What are the typical mortgage rates and down payment requirements for homes in Saltese, MT?
Mortgage rates in Saltese generally align with national averages but can be influenced by the rural nature of the county and property types. For conventional loans, a 20% down payment is standard to avoid PMI, but many local lenders offer programs with as little as 3-5% down, especially for primary residences. Given the lower median home prices compared to urban Montana, a strong down payment can significantly reduce monthly payments.
Are there any Montana-specific or local first-time homebuyer programs accessible in Saltese?
Yes, the Montana Board of Housing (MBOH) offers the "Mortgage Credit Certificate (MCC)" and "Bond Program," which provide below-market interest rates and federal tax credits for eligible first-time buyers in Saltese. These programs have income and purchase price limits that are very attainable for the Saltese area. It's advisable to work with a lender approved by the MBOH to navigate these opportunities.
How does buying land or a rural property in Saltese affect the mortgage process?
Purchasing undeveloped land or a home on a large acreage in Saltese often requires a different loan product, like a rural land loan or a USDA construction loan, as conventional mortgages may not apply. Properties must meet specific criteria for well, septic, and road access. Working with a local lender experienced in rural Mineral County properties is crucial, as they understand the unique appraisal and approval challenges.
What should I know about property taxes and insurance when calculating my mortgage payment in Saltese?
Mineral County, where Saltese is located, has relatively modest property tax rates, which can be a benefit for your overall housing cost. However, you must factor in the potential cost of additional insurance, such as flood insurance if near the Clark Fork River or wildfire insurance given the forested terrain. Your lender will help escrow these amounts, but getting local quotes early in the process is essential for an accurate budget.
Are USDA Rural Development loans a viable option for mortgages in Saltese, MT?
Absolutely. Saltese is located in a USDA-eligible rural area, making the USDA Single Family Housing Guaranteed Loan Program a popular and attractive option. This program offers 100% financing (no down payment) for low-to-moderate income buyers purchasing a primary residence. Given Saltese's designation, many homes and buyers qualify, making homeownership more accessible without a large upfront cash requirement.
